As all others have said, docking a rats tail is NOT a good idea. While there are tailless breeders out there (I bred the first dumbo tailless in the Northwest) it's very hard on a rat. Tailless breeders breed manx rats to a certain standard. There is a great chance of manx rats having spina befita and balance problems, and them not being able to regulate their temperature. Manx rats are born with their hips set wider apart, to compensate for their lack of tail which helps in balance. Please wait until you are older and moved out to get a rat if your mom dislikes their tails. Docking tails just to make a rat prettier is inhumane.
